Create a Serene Workspace: Top Home Office Decor Ideas

When designing your home office, creating a serene and inspiring environment is key to productivity and well-being. Incorporate elements that promote relaxation and focus, starting with a calming color palette. Opt for peaceful hues like blues, greens, or soft neutrals to create a sense of calm. Supplement your space with natural materials like wood, bamboo, or plants to bring the outdoors in and foster a connection to nature.

  • Leverage natural light by positioning your desk near a window.
  • Consider adding a comfortable seating setup to encourage breaks and relaxation.
  • Declutter your workspace regularly to minimize distractions and promote a sense of order.

Personalize your office with photography that inspire you, and include a few personal touches that make the space feel uniquely yours. Remember, your home office should be a reflection of your style and likes.
